

Zero Balance Savings Account is a type of account where you are not required to maintain a minimum balance. It is one of the most difficult tasks to maintain a minimum balance in the account. A majority of banks in India are at least keeping a limit of Rs.10,000 per account to maintain. This thing becomes problematic for the people who are earning enough to meet the requirements.
In such cases, Zero Balance Savings Account is the most ideal option as there is no stipulated minimum balance and you are at liberty to withdraw funds anytime and leave the account empty. Discussed below are some of the top zero balance savings accounts in 2020 for Indian Citizens.

If you do not wish to maintain the monthly average balance (MAB) in your savings account, then opting for a zero balance savings account is the most suitable option. The Monthly Average Balance is a sum of all the end-of-day closing balance divided by the number of days in that month. A zero balance savings account provides all the usual facilities that come with a regular savings bank account. IDFC First Bank Pratham Savings Account
Account Name | Account Balance | Rate of Interest (% p.a.) |
Pratham Savings Account | For balance <= Rs.1 lakh | 6.00% |
> Rs.1 lakh and <= Rs 1 crore | 7.00% |
Features of Pratham Savings Account
- Pratham Savings Account is a zero balance that comes with the privilege of unlimited ATM withdrawals
- You can make quick transactions at any micro ATM
- Get free access to the internet and mobile banking
- Pay online bills hassle-free and get a free mini statement and know about account balances anytime and from anywhere
- You can apply for this account using your Aadhaar Card at the nearest bank branch

Standard Chartered Bank- Aasaan / BSBDA
Account Name | Account Balance | Rate of Interest (% p.a.) |
Aasaan | Up to Rs.50 lakh | 3.00% |
Above Rs.50 lakh & up to Rs.150 crore | 3.50% | |
>=Rs.150 crore to < Rs.300 crore | 1.00% | |
>= Rs.300 crore | 0.50% |
Note: Interest will be calculated at applicable Savings Bank Interest Rate on the daily available balance and the same will be paid at quarterly rests.
Features of Aasaan
- Open your account instantly using Aadhaar based eKYC
- Get an International Platinum debit card free for the first year and enjoy 15% off across 600 restaurants
- Get free monthly account statements and free passbook
- Free NEFT / RTGS transactions
- Fee cash deposit, cash withdrawal, DD and PO

Conclusion
In a large market like today’s where there are thousands of products catering to all the different financial and banking needs of the individuals, it is important to choose the right type of Savings Account for future reference. There are lots of parameters that need to be considered while opting for the best Zero Balance Savings Account. You need to keep in mind certain important criteria including the interest rate, transaction charges, net banking facility, cash withdrawal and deposit limit, the security of funds, and more. All these features vary from bank to bank and hence need to be kept in consideration while choosing the best suited Zero Balance Savings Account to cater to all your financial needs.
